Walmart
Walmart allows you to shop online using your checking account and accepts eCheck payments. To use your checking account as a payment option, you can call Customer Service to place an order using a check or money order.
Keep in mind that your check must be in US dollars and from a US bank, as they won’t accept foreign checks. Walmart accepts personal checks and money orders, so once you’ve placed your order, you can send them your payment along with a copy of your receipt or by noting your order number on the check or money order.
If you choose to send a check, please note that your order will only be processed after the check clears, which typically takes around 5 business days for most US banks.
Aside from checks, Walmart also accepts several other payment methods such as major credit cards, debit cards, Walmart gift cards, and PayPal.

Amazon
You can’t talk about online retailers that accept eChecks without mentioning Amazon. When it comes to online shopping, Amazon reigns supreme, and they recognize the importance of providing various payment options, including eChecks.
Now, if you’d like to use your checking account during the checkout process, you can follow these steps: at the Shipping and Payment stage, select “Add a checking account.” Then, enter the bank routing number (also known as the ABA code) and your account number. It’s important to have an ACH-enabled checking account at a US bank branch.
Additionally, provide the name, address, and valid US driver’s license number or state-issued ID number of the principal account holder, along with the issuing state.
Note that if you’re uncertain whether your account allows electronic payments, it’s best to contact your bank to confirm. As long as your checking account is a personal account located at a US bank branch, you can use it for payment. However, savings accounts are not eligible for this payment method.
Lastly, please be aware that corporate and business bank accounts are only accepted for Amazon Business Accounts. Keep in mind that routing numbers consist of nine digits, while account numbers can be up to 17 digits long.

Target
While it doesn’t exactly meet the necessary requirements to be on this list due to the fact that Target doesn’t offer checks as a payment option on its website, it’s still a notable inclusion. Yes, they allow checks as a payment option.
Target is a store that happily accepts personal checks as a payment method for purchases made in-store. However, it’s important to note that Target does not provide check cashing services. When using a check to pay at Target, it may be necessary to present a photo ID for verification purposes. Fortunately, Target accepts a variety of photo IDs issued by state, federal, or military authorities. This includes valid driver’s licenses or state-issued, non-driver identification cards.
One great thing about paying by check at Target is that there are no specific requirements regarding the minimum amount you can spend or any limits imposed on the check payment option. This means that you have the freedom to use a check for purchases of any amount at Target.
However, it’s essential to keep in mind that Target exclusively accepts personal checks issued by banks located in the United States. They do not accept any form of foreign checks, traveler’s checks, cashier’s checks, or any other types of checks apart from personal ones.
So, if you’re planning to pay by check at Target, make sure it’s a personal check from a U.S. bank account and have your photo ID handy to complete the transaction smoothly.
